The Rise Of Property Guardians: How This Innovative Housing Solution Is Shaping The Future

In recent years, property guardianship has gained traction as a creative housing solution for both property owners and individuals in need of affordable accommodations. This unique concept involves individuals living in vacant properties as guardians, providing security and maintenance in exchange for reduced rent. This arrangement benefits property owners by deterring vandalism and squatting while also offering affordable housing options for tenants.

property guardianship has emerged as a popular alternative to traditional renting, especially in cities where the demand for housing far exceeds supply. With rising rent prices and a shortage of affordable housing options, many individuals are turning to property guardianship as a way to save money on accommodation while also contributing to the upkeep of vacant properties.

The concept of property guardianship is simple: individuals, known as property guardians, are granted permission to live in vacant properties in exchange for keeping the property secure and well-maintained. This arrangement benefits property owners by providing them with a cost-effective solution to preventing squatting and vandalism. property guardianship also gives tenants the opportunity to live in unique and often spacious accommodations at a fraction of the cost of traditional renting.

One of the key benefits of property guardianship is its affordability. Since property guardians are living in vacant properties that would otherwise be unoccupied, the rent they pay is typically much lower than market rates. This allows individuals who may be struggling to afford rent in a traditional housing market to find affordable accommodations through property guardianship.

Another benefit of property guardianship is the flexibility it offers tenants. Unlike traditional renting, property guardianship agreements are typically short-term and can be flexible to accommodate the needs of both the property owner and the tenant. This flexibility makes property guardianship an attractive option for individuals who may be in between housing situations or who are looking for temporary accommodations.

property guardianship also provides tenants with the opportunity to live in unique and often unconventional spaces. From old schools and churches to office buildings and warehouses, property guardianship offers individuals the chance to experience living in spaces that they may not have access to through traditional renting.

Despite its many benefits, property guardianship is not without its challenges. Property guardians are required to adhere to strict rules and regulations set forth by the property owner, which can sometimes limit the freedom and autonomy of the tenant. Additionally, property guardianship agreements are typically short-term, so tenants may need to be prepared to move on short notice.
